Default 1989 Vacuum pump woes

The vacuum assist brakes have been progressively getting worse. It's so bad now that I'm getting virtually no assist. I attached a vacuum gauge to the vacuum pump and it it produces 8 inHg at idle and 12 inHg with throttle. As soon as I turn off the engine, vacuum drops to zero. When I blow into the vacuum pump, I can hear air leaking. Is this not normal?

What's my best option here? The second option is much less expensive because I already have all the parts except the electric vacuum pump which is relatively inexpensive.

Option 1
Convert to 2nd Gen Vane style vacuum/power steering pump?

Option 2
Buy electric vacuum pump from 03-04 Dodge cummins
Convert brakes to hydroboost
